> ive had the resolvconf package stomp all over my /etc/resolv.conf file
> before.

If resolvconf is installed /etc/resolv.conf should be a symlink to the real file /etc/resolvconf/run/resolv.conf which is managed by resolvconf and indicates changes you make will be overwritten.

Instead you should add name server information to one or more of your interface listings in /etc/network/interfaces with a line like:

dns-nameservers 204.127.198.4 63.240.76.4

resolvconf will take care of the rest when the relevant interface is started or stopped. Many packages that in the past would have handled /etc/resolv.conf in their own way have been updated to use resolvconf if it is installed. If you have resolvconf installed you should read the readme in /usr/share/doc/resolvconf to see if something your are using is known not to play well with resolvconf.
